Kioskwarden is the watchdog that supervises the Lumenbooth kiosk app at all Drayfield Transit locations. If the watchdog reports three consecutive heartbeat failures, it locks the kiosk's service account and requires manual recovery. To recover, open the maintenance panel, select Account Recovery, and confirm the device serial shown on screen. The panel will then prompt for the recovery passphrase, which is noted immediately below for reference.

vault phrase of bagaf-kajeg = jorath-feniel-briir-siliel-ralix

Pool Car Key Cabinet — Contractor Note

Pool cars at the Drayfell Depot are booked through the front desk. Keys live in the grey cabinet in the corridor behind reception. Take only the key matching your booking slip, sign the sheet on the cabinet door, and return keys before leaving site. Fuel cards stay with the keys. Report any damage immediately. The cabinet opens with the keypad code given below.

staff pass of kawip-hawef = bdg-QLP-2

Handover: Opaline billing worker, blue-green deploys. Tamsin — everything you need is in the runbook, but the essentials: we run two identical pools, green takes live invoice traffic while blue warms. Cut-over flips the queue binding, never the load balancer, because in-flight charges must drain first. Allow fifteen minutes of overlap and watch the dedup counter before retiring the old pool. Both pools must run identical settings; the canonical configuration is as follows.

deployment values, yafop-tahof:
HOLIX_HOST=holix.zemvarsys.internal
HOLIX_PORT=3306

EXIF scrubbing is failing on the Fernhollow media ingest workers. Uploads pass through scrub-px but metadata is left intact, and the error log shows the scrubber rejecting requests from the quarantine bucket. Root cause: the staging env file was copied to prod without the bucket access credential, so the scrubber silently falls back to pass-through mode. Fix is straightforward. On each affected worker, open /etc/pxscrub/.env and add the following line, then restart the service:

secret setting of hawep-yahig: LEDGER_TOKEN29=41b5d6315371c92885eaeb077fb63